Pauline heads the Banking & Finance practice and is also a Director in the Corporate & Finance Department. She has more than two decades of experience representing and advising clients on a wide range of local and cross-border loan and financing transactions. More specifically, Pauline has worked on bilateral and syndicated loan facilities to borrowers from the ASEAN countries, the Asia Pacific region, and Europe. She has advised clients on the financing of infrastructure projects including power plant and highway construction projects, property construction financing, acquisition financing, ship financing, and loan restructuring and rescheduling.
Pauline is recognised by prestigious legal publications for her Banking & Finance work. She is described to be “highly competent”, "highly professional, responsive and knowledgeable" and holds a “fine record in syndicated and bilateral lending, acquisition finance and project finance”.
